Transaction 8b976eee1434de4d19db72a77e82658a8114f8108943b4c88d768d7f9fa41ca7
1 Input
1 Output
-
8b976eee1434de4d19db72a77e82658a8114f8108943b4c88d768d7f9fa41ca7:0
- value
- 3444119
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d44c5aca71c28c898e83d01546bbc6240b3654ee OP_EQUAL
- address
- 3M3YeRfKH9GrSYJsWoEDRam4tVCvP9UPaY